​A Caring Alternative, LLC is a nationally CARF accredited behavioral health service provider with Morganton, Marion, Hickory, and Asheville, NC. We provide an array of services to Alexander, Buncombe, Burke, Catawba, Caldwell, McDowell, Mitchell, Iredell, Lincoln, Ashe, Avery, Watauga, Wilkes, Rutherford, and Yancey counties which consist of Assertive Community Treatment Team, Community Support Team, Day Treatment, Integrated Care, Intensive In-Home, Medication Management, Outpatient Therapy, and Therapeutic Foster Care. We are CARF accredited, and CABHA certified.

 

All applicants must be deeply committed to a high quality of mental health care for the client. Many positions require travel daily in the local community to provide skill-building and supportive counseling and assist the consumer in developing critical daily living and coping skills.

 

All individuals must meet these additional requirements:

  • Must have a clean driving record and current NC driver’s license.

  • Must have a successful criminal background check and two satisfactory references.
